  3. Question Time!! Penny is the Member of Parliament for the North End Area of Portsmouth and is coming into school on Friday 25th November to answer any questions you may have for her. Nelson ward takes in the gateway to our city and Penny would like to see a serious plan devised for the regeneration of Tipner. Penny is also trying to get funding secured to give North End shopping centre a much needed facelift to  revitalise this once thriving local shopping area.
